Boryl ligands and their roles in metal-catalysed borylation reactions.

Li Dang1, Zhenyang Lin, Todd B Marder.   

Abstract

In this feature article, we discuss selected recent aspects of metal boryl (M-BR2) chemistry pertaining, in particular, to the role of late and post-transition metal boryl complexes in various catalytic processes. The exceptionally strong sigma-donor properties of boryl ligands and their related nucleophilic behaviour are highlighted.
